CultureTimmy the whale’s death inspires satirical play exploring German identity

A stranded humpback whale on Germany’s Baltic coast became the focus of a daring rescue effort in April. For a short time, the mission appeared to unite a country troubled by political division and economic anxiety. The satirical play Timmy: Hope Dies Last turns the whale into a Jesus-like figure associated with both hope and grief. It suggests that the spectators, social-media influencers, politicians and millionaires who gathered at the seaside wanted more than to save Timmy. They wanted the whale to save them.
